Surety Contract Bonds Are Expensive
Surety contract bonds aren't always pricey, as opposed to common belief. Many people think that getting a surety bond for an agreement will certainly result in large prices. Nonetheless, this isn't necessarily the instance.
The expense of a guaranty bond is figured out by various elements, such as the type of bond, the bond amount, and the risk included. It's important to recognize that surety bond costs are a tiny portion of the bond amount, commonly ranging from 1% to 15%.
In addition, the monetary security and credit reliability of the specialist play a significant function in identifying the bond premium. So, if you have a good credit report and a strong monetary standing, you may be able to protect a guaranty agreement bond at an affordable price.

Guaranty Contract Bonds Are Just Required for Huge Jobs
You may be surprised to learn that surety agreement bonds aren't solely required for huge tasks. While it's true that these bonds are frequently connected with large construction endeavors, they're likewise required for smaller tasks. Here are 3 reasons surety contract bonds aren't restricted to massive endeavors:
1. Legal requirements: Certain jurisdictions mandate making use of guaranty contract bonds for all building jobs, regardless of their dimension. This makes sure that professionals meet their obligations and secures the rate of interests of all parties included.
2. Danger reduction: Even tiny projects can entail considerable economic investments and possible dangers. Surety agreement bonds offer assurance to task proprietors that their investment is secured, despite the project's dimension.
3. Integrity and depend on: Guaranty contract bonds show a contractor's financial stability, experience, and integrity. This is essential for clients, whether the project is big or small, as it provides confidence in the contractor's ability to provide the task effectively.
Guaranty Contract Bonds Are the Same as Insurance policy
Unlike common belief, there's a vital difference between guaranty contract bonds and insurance coverage. While both offer a type of monetary protection, they offer different purposes on the planet of company.
Surety contract bonds are particularly designed to assure the performance of a service provider or a company on a project. They make certain that the specialist satisfies their legal responsibilities and completes the task as agreed upon.
On the other hand, insurance policies safeguard versus unforeseen events and give protection for losses or damages. Insurance coverage is implied to compensate policyholders for losses that occur as a result of mishaps, theft, or various other covered occasions.
